Introduction
The aim of this document is to give the design engineer a comprehensive “tool kit” to better understand the behavior of VIPower high side switches, allowing easier design and saving time and money. Today’s VIPower high side switches represent the 5th generation of smart power drivers (the so called M0-5). In this latest generation of drivers, all the experience and know-how derived from previous generations have been implemented in order to improve robustness, increase functionality and raise package density while maintaining lower prices. The complexity of a modern High Side Driver (HSD) is still relatively low compared to many other logic ICs. However, the combination of digital logic functions with analog power structures supplied by an unstabilized automotive battery system across a wide temperature range is very challenging for such a device. The M0-5 components today meet all the above criteria, providing an optimal price/performance ratio by offering the highest performance and robustness at excellent prices.
